Although Claudio Ranieri’s triumphant Leicester City outfit were nonetheless offered something of an ‘easy’ run of opponents among the Champions League group-stages this season, no one could accuse the ever determined Foxes of failing to take their historic European duties seriously in 2016/17.

 

With a maximum nine points taken from their opening three Champions League fixtures in-fact – against the likes of Club Brugge, FC Porto and FC Copenhagen respectively – Leicester City deserve all the relevant credit they can get right in the here and now, with dreams of making it all the way to the Champions League final still within reach for Claudio Ranieri’s boys in blue.
